In yet another indication of the deteriorating law & order situation in MVA-ruled Maharashtra, two kerosene bombs were hurled at the office of Shankar Jagtap, a builder and brother of BJP MLA Laxman Jagtap, on Tuesday afternoon in Pimpri Chinchwad, Pune.

No one was hurt in the incident as the occupants of the office were inside the building.

Pimpri Chinchwad police said the incident took place around 2.30 pm at the office of Shankar Jagtap, located in Pimple Saudagar in Pimpri Chinchwad area. They have launched a manhunt to nab the suspects after CCTV footage from the area showed three persons hurling the bombs.

Deputy Commissioner of Police (Zone 2) Anand Bhoite said, “The CCTV footage shows three persons on the bike and hurling these kerosene-filled bottles used as crude bombs, with possibly a cloth being used as a wick. Upon preliminary investigation, the fuel seems to be kerosene. At the time of the incident, the office was open and Shankar Jagtap was present inside.”

DCP Bhoite further said, “One of the bombs struck at a distance near the gate of the compound and another hit next to the door of the office. After striking, these bottles burst into flames but no one was hurt.”

The police have seized assets valued at Rs 50 crore belonging to Shaheed Khan a.k.a. Chhote, a village head, identified as the leader of a gang operating from Bareilly district for the past several years.

Additional Superintendent of Police (Rural) Rajkumar Agarwal termed this as ‘the biggest action against any drug mafia in the state so far.’

The police have also sought permission to attach assets worth Rs 16.5 crore of his nephew, Taimur Khan a.k.a. Bhola, who allegedly runs another gang of drug suppliers in Bareilly.

According to police, Shaheed Khan, 52, is currently lodged in the district jail while most of his family members are either behind bars or have gone underground.

Taimur Khan, 35, is lodged in Delhi’s Tihar jail.

The additional SP said, “We have taken action under the relevant sections of the Narcotic Drugs and Psychotropic Substances Act. Now, these accused or their family members cannot sell, rent or gift these properties to anyone.”

Shaheed’s assets include a shopping complex, agricultural land, a marriage hall, luxurious cars and multiple houses, he added.

The police officer informed that Shaheed and his nephew, Saif, were arrested on August 18 at the Padhera village under the Fatehganj police limits.

Twenty kilograms of heroin, valued at Rs 20 crore in the Indian market and three times more in the international market, was seized from them.

“We found out that Shaheed has a vast network. He gets opium and other narcotic substances from Jharkhand and processes them into top quality smack, which is in high demand in Uttar Pradesh, Punjab, Haryana and Delhi. The police had identified various assets acquired by Shaheed over the past six years, using the money earned from smuggling drugs,” he said.

He further said, “We froze the assets and reported them to the Smugglers and Foreign Exchange Manipulators (Forfeit of property) Act tribunal for forfeiting the assets. Shaheed filed an appeal against the move and was asked to provide details about the source of income for the assets he and his family had bought.”

Shaheed and his family could only provide the sources for property worth Rs 1 crore.

“The SAFEMA tribunal thereafter ordered seizure of the remaining property worth over Rs 50 crore,” the additional SP said.

After remaining under the ‘severe’ category for more than week, the Air Quality Index (AQI) in the national capital improved to ‘poor’ on Tuesday.

In its forecast, the India Meteorological Department (IMD) had predicted that the pollution level in the national capital could improve due to strong winds, while the sky will also remain clear throughout the day.

According to the Central Pollution Control Board (CPCB), the AQI as of 9 a.m. at Anand Vihar was 300, Ashok Vihar 283, Shri Aurobindo Marg 265, Punjabi Bagh 311, Mandir Marg 271, IGI Airport 230, Lodhi Road 241 and Rohini 288.

An AQI between zero and 50 is considered ‘good’; 51 and 100 ‘satisfactory’; 101 and 200 ‘moderate’; 201 and 300 ‘poor’; 301 and 400 ‘very poor’; and between 401 and 500 ‘severe’.

Meanwhile, the IMD said that the maximum temperature on Tuesday is expected to be 26 degrees Celsius and the minimum 11 degrees Celsius.

On November 6, Delhi’s Air Quality Index (AQI) was in the “severe” category, with emissions from stubble burning (a seasonal phenomenon heavily concentrated in Punjab, and parts of Haryana) contributing to 36% of the pollution, as per data from SAFAR.

Anangadi Koyamon alias Hydroskutty and Kalluvencheveettil Nizamudeen, the last two accused in the infamous Marad massacre, were pronounced guilty by the special court handling the matter. The special judge K.S. Ambika sentenced both of them to double life imprisonment. The gruesome killings of Hindus happened at a fishing village called Marad in Kozhikode district of north Kerala on May 2, 2003.

Around 90 Islamists went on a rampage armed with swords, knives and country-made bombs that were kept in a local mosque. 8 Hindus and a Muslim were killed that day. The Muslim who was killed died after sustaining injuries from his own co-assailants. 16 Hindus including 2 women were seriously injured that night.

Both Koyamon & Nizamudeen were tried separately since they had absconded when the trial was taking place. Koyamon was the bomb maker and Nizamudeen had directly taken part in the killings. Both had taken part in the conspiracy. 

Nizamudeen was caught from the Karipur airport while trying to escape to an Arab country in October 2010. Koyamon escaped to Hyderabad but was arrested from his hideout near South Beach, Kozhikode in January 2011.

The accused were charged with conspiracy, murder, attempt to murder, promoting enmity between different religions, unlawful assembly, rioting with deadly weapons, house trespassing to commit an offense and for hurt using dangerous weapons. Sections related to the explosives substances act, arms act and misuse of religious institutions were also imposed.

In January 2009, 62 of the 148 accused were sentenced to life imprisonment and 1 was awarded a 5-year-term for abetment.  24 others were later sentenced to life by the Kerala High court. In April 2012, the Kerala High Court noted that there was a deep conspiracy behind the incident and added that the police failed to investigate effectively. In a decision that has sent shock waves all around, the Allahabad High Court has lowered the penalty imposed by the Special Sessions Court on one Sonu Kushwaha, a convict, found guilty of having oral sex with a 10-year-old minor child in lieu of Rs 20.

The single-judge bench of Justice Anil Kumar Ojha reduced Sonu Kushwaha’s punishment from 10 years to 7 years, observing that the crime committed by him is ‘less serious’.

Justice Anil Kumar Ojha was hearing an appeal filed by Sonu Kushwaha against a Special Sessions Court verdict convicting him under the Indian Penal Code’s Sections 377 (unnatural offences) and 506 (punishment for criminal intimidation), as well as Section 6 of the POCSO Act.

The judgment said that it would not fall within the purview of either of the two sections, but it is punishable under section 4 of the POCSO Act.

“It is clear that offence committed by appellant neither falls under Section 5/6 of POCSO Act nor under Section 9(M) of POCSO Act because there is penetrative sexual assault in the present case as the appellant has put his penis into mouth of victim. Putting penis into mouth does not fall in the category of aggravated sexual assault or sexual assault. It comes into category of penetrative sexual assault which is punishable under Section 4 of POCSO Act,” the Court observed.

The Court reduced the sentence of the appellant from 10 years of rigorous imprisonment to 7 years, and a fine of Rs 5,000, since ‘penetrative sexual assault’ under Section 4 is a “lesser offence” than ‘aggravated penetrative sexual assault’ under Section 6.

The appellant Sonu Kushwaha was accused of going to the complainant’s house and taking the complainant’s 10-year-old kid with him. “In exchange for Rs 20, he urged the child to put his penis in his mouth. When the child returned home, his family inquired as to where he obtained the money from”.

Upon being coerced that child narrated the ordeal. He said that Sonu Kushwaha had threatened him with dire consequences if he revealed the truth. The parents of the minor subsequently filed a complaint against Sonu Kushwaha.
